History and Origin

The history of the Shiranian dog breed is largely unknown, but it is believed to have originated in the United States. This breed is a cross between the Pomeranian and the Shih Tzu, two popular toy breeds that have been around for centuries.

The Pomeranian is a breed that originated in Pomerania, a region that is now part of Germany and Poland. These dogs were originally used as herding dogs and were also popular with royalty. They were brought to England in the 18th century, where they became popular with the royal family.

The Shih Tzu, on the other hand, is a breed that originated in China more than 1,000 years ago. They were bred to be companion dogs and were often kept by royalty. They were brought to England and the United States in the early 20th century and quickly became popular as pets.

The Shiranian is a relatively new breed and was likely first bred in the United States in the late 20th century. The breed was developed to create a small, friendly companion dog that would be easy to care for and train.

In summary, the Shiranian is a cross between the Pomeranian and the Shih Tzu, two popular toy breeds with a long history. While the exact origin of the breed is unknown, it is believed to have been developed in the United States in the late 20th century.

Physical Characteristics

The Shiranian, a mix between a Pomeranian and a Shih Tzu, is a small breed that typically stands between 7 to 10 inches tall and weighs between 4 to 13 pounds. They have a compact body with a short muzzle, round eyes, and floppy ears.

One of the most notable physical characteristics of the Shiranian is their long, double coat which can be either wavy or straight depending on which parent breed they take after. The fur can come in a variety of colors, including black, red, orange, gold, sable, and brindle. They can also have a solid coat or a combination of colors.

Their coat requires regular grooming to prevent matting and tangling. Regular brushing and occasional trimming are necessary to keep their coat healthy and shiny.

In terms of color, Shiranians can have a black coat, which is a relatively rare color for this breed. Red, orange, and gold are also common colors for Shiranians. Sable and brindle coats are also possible, which can give them a unique and attractive appearance.

Overall, the Shiranian is a small and attractive breed with a long, double coat that requires regular grooming. They come in a variety of colors, including black, red, orange, gold, sable, and brindle.

Grooming and Shedding

Grooming and Shedding - Shih Tzu Pomeranian Mix

As a Shih Tzu Pomeranian Mix owner, you need to be prepared to groom your furry friend regularly. Grooming your dog can help maintain their health and keep their coat looking neat and clean.

Coat

Shih Tzu Pomeranian Mixes have long, fluffy coats that require regular grooming to prevent matting and tangling. You should brush your dog’s coat at least once a day to keep it looking neat and healthy. Use a slicker brush and a metal comb to remove any tangles or mats.

Grooming

Bathing your dog is also an important part of grooming. You should bathe your Shih Tzu Pomeranian Mix every two to three months using a gentle dog shampoo. Avoid using human shampoo as it can be too harsh for your dog’s sensitive skin.

Trimming your dog’s hair is also necessary to maintain cleanliness and prevent discomfort. Trim the hair around their eyes, ears, and paws to prevent irritation and infection. You can also trim the hair around the anus to keep your dog clean and prevent matting.

Shedding

Shih Tzu Pomeranian Mixes are moderate shedders. Regular grooming can help reduce shedding, but you should still expect some shedding throughout the year. You can use a de-shedding tool to remove loose hair and reduce shedding.

In summary, grooming your Shih Tzu Pomeranian Mix is an essential part of owning one of these adorable dogs. Regular grooming can help maintain their health and keep their coat looking neat and clean. Bathing, brushing, and trimming your dog’s hair are all necessary parts of grooming. Additionally, using a de-shedding tool can help reduce shedding.

Adoption and Cost

Adoption and Cost - Shih Tzu Pomeranian Mix

If you are interested in adopting a Shih Tzu Pomeranian mix, there are a few options available to you. You can either adopt from a shelter or rescue organization or purchase from a reputable breeder.

Adopting a shelter or rescue organization is a great way to give a dog in need a loving home. You can search for adoptable dogs in your area on websites like Adopt-a-Pet or Petfinder. Adoption fees for dogs can range from $50 to $500 depending on the organization and location.

If you decide to purchase from a breeder, it is important to do your research and find a reputable breeder. A reputable breeder will provide you with health certificates for the puppy’s parents, allow you to meet the puppy’s parents, and ensure that the puppy has been socialized properly. The cost of a Shih Tzu Pomeranian mix from a breeder can range from $500 to $2,000 depending on the breeder and the puppy’s lineage.

It is important to note that the cost of owning a dog goes beyond the initial adoption or purchase fee. You will also need to budget for food, toys, grooming, and veterinary care. It is recommended that you budget at least $1,000 per year for these expenses.

Whether you choose to adopt or purchase, it is important to remember that owning a dog is a long-term commitment. Make sure you are prepared to provide a loving and safe home for your new furry friend for the entirety of their life.

Feeding Guidelines for Puppies and Adults

Feeding Guidelines for Puppies and Adults - Shih Tzu Pomeranian Mix

Feeding your Shiranian puppy and adult dog is an essential aspect of their overall health and well-being. Here are some feeding guidelines to ensure your furry friend stays healthy and happy:

Puppies

Puppies require a different feeding schedule than adult dogs. You should feed your Shiranian puppy three to four times a day until they are six months old. After six months, you can reduce their feedings to twice a day.

When it comes to the amount of food, it depends on your puppy’s weight, age, and activity level. A general guideline is to feed your puppy 1/4 to 1/2 cup of high-quality puppy food per day, divided into three to four meals.

It’s essential to choose a puppy food that is formulated for small breeds. Small breed puppy food has the right balance of nutrients to support their growth and development. You should avoid feeding your puppy table scraps or human food as it can lead to obesity and other health issues.

Adults

When your Shiranian reaches adulthood, you should feed them twice a day. The amount of food you feed them depends on their weight, age, and activity level. A general guideline is to feed your adult Shiranian 1/2 to 1 cup of high-quality dog food per day, divided into two meals.

It’s essential to choose a dog food that is formulated for small breeds. Small breed dog food has the right balance of nutrients to support their health and well-being. You should avoid feeding your dog table scraps or human food as it can lead to obesity and other health issues.

Weight and Height

Shiranians are small dogs, and it’s essential to monitor their weight and height. Overfeeding can lead to obesity, which can lead to health issues such as diabetes, heart disease, and joint problems.

A healthy Shiranian should weigh between 4 to 13 pounds and stand between 7 to 10 inches tall. You can monitor their weight by weighing them regularly and adjusting their food intake accordingly.

In conclusion, feeding your Shiranian puppy and adult dog the right amount of high-quality dog food is essential for their overall health and well-being. By following these feeding guidelines, you can ensure your furry friend stays healthy and happy for years to come.
